قد تكون الصورة تمثيلية.
راجع المواصفات للحصول على تفاصيل المنتج.
LCMXO3L-6900C-6BG256C

LCMXO3L-6900C-6BG256C

Product Overview

Category: Programmable Logic Device (PLD)

Use: The LCMXO3L-6900C-6BG256C is a high-performance PLD designed for various digital logic applications. It offers flexible and customizable solutions for circuit design and implementation.

Characteristics: - Low power consumption - High-speed performance - Small form factor - Easy integration with other components

Package: The LCMXO3L-6900C-6BG256C comes in a 256-ball grid array (BGA) package, which provides a compact and reliable solution for circuit board assembly.

Essence: This PLD is built on advanced semiconductor technology, allowing for efficient and reliable digital logic operations.

Packaging/Quantity: The LCMXO3L-6900C-6BG256C is typically sold individually or in small quantities, depending on the supplier.

Specifications

  • Logic Cells: 6,900
  • I/O Pins: 256
  • Operating Voltage: 1.2V
  • Maximum Frequency: 300 MHz
  • Configuration Memory: 256 Kbits
  • Embedded Block RAM: 360 Kbits
  • Programmable Interconnect Points: 13,824

Detailed Pin Configuration

The LCMXO3L-6900C-6BG256C has 256 I/O pins, each of which can be configured as an input or output. These pins are organized into banks, providing flexibility in connecting external devices and peripherals.

For a detailed pin configuration diagram, please refer to the product datasheet.

Functional Features

  • Flexible Logic Cells: The LCMXO3L-6900C-6BG256C offers a large number of logic cells, allowing for complex digital circuit designs.
  • High-Speed Performance: With a maximum operating frequency of 300 MHz, this PLD can handle demanding applications that require fast data processing.
  • Low Power Consumption: The device is designed to minimize power consumption, making it suitable for battery-powered or energy-efficient systems.
  • Easy Integration: The LCMXO3L-6900C-6BG256C can be easily integrated with other components, enabling seamless system integration.

Advantages and Disadvantages

Advantages: - High-performance capabilities - Low power consumption - Compact form factor - Flexible and customizable design options

Disadvantages: - Limited logic cell count compared to higher-end PLDs - Higher cost compared to simpler programmable logic devices

Working Principles

The LCMXO3L-6900C-6BG256C operates based on the principles of programmable logic. It consists of configurable logic cells that can be programmed to perform various digital logic functions, such as AND, OR, and XOR operations. These logic cells are interconnected through programmable interconnect points, allowing for the creation of complex digital circuits.

The device's configuration memory stores the user-defined logic functions and interconnections, which can be loaded during startup or reconfigured dynamically during operation.

Detailed Application Field Plans

The LCMXO3L-6900C-6BG256C finds applications in various fields, including:

  1. Embedded Systems: It can be used in embedded systems to implement custom logic functions, interface with peripherals, and control system behavior.
  2. Communications: The PLD can be utilized in communication systems for protocol handling, signal processing, and data manipulation.
  3. Industrial Automation: It enables the implementation of control algorithms, sensor interfacing, and real-time monitoring in industrial automation systems.
  4. Consumer Electronics: The device can be employed in consumer electronics for custom logic functions, user interface control, and signal processing.

Detailed and Complete Alternative Models

  1. LCMXO2-1200ZE-1TG100C: A lower-cost alternative with fewer logic cells but similar features.
  2. LCMXO3LF-6900C-6BG484C: A higher-capacity variant with more logic cells and I/O pins.
  3. LCMXO3L-2100E-5MG324C: A smaller form factor option with reduced logic cell count, suitable for space-constrained applications.

These alternative models offer different trade-offs in terms of cost, capacity, and package options, allowing users to choose the most suitable PLD for their specific requirements.

Word Count: 550 words

قم بإدراج 10 أسئلة وإجابات شائعة تتعلق بتطبيق LCMXO3L-6900C-6BG256C في الحلول التقنية

Sure! Here are 10 common questions and answers related to the application of LCMXO3L-6900C-6BG256C in technical solutions:

  1. Q: What is the LCMXO3L-6900C-6BG256C? A: The LCMXO3L-6900C-6BG256C is a specific model of Field-Programmable Gate Array (FPGA) manufactured by Lattice Semiconductor.

  2. Q: What are the key features of the LCMXO3L-6900C-6BG256C? A: Some key features include 6,900 Look-Up Tables (LUTs), 256 user I/O pins, low power consumption, and support for various interfaces like SPI, I2C, UART, etc.

  3. Q: What are the typical applications of LCMXO3L-6900C-6BG256C? A: The LCMXO3L-6900C-6BG256C is commonly used in applications such as industrial automation, robotics, IoT devices, motor control, and sensor interfacing.

  4. Q: How can I program the LCMXO3L-6900C-6BG256C? A: The LCMXO3L-6900C-6BG256C can be programmed using Lattice Diamond or Lattice Radiant software tools, which support various programming languages like VHDL and Verilog.

  5. Q: What is the power supply requirement for LCMXO3L-6900C-6BG256C? A: The LCMXO3L-6900C-6BG256C operates at a voltage range of 1.14V to 1.26V, and it requires a stable power supply with appropriate decoupling capacitors.

  6. Q: Can I use the LCMXO3L-6900C-6BG256C in battery-powered devices? A: Yes, the LCMXO3L-6900C-6BG256C is designed to be power-efficient, making it suitable for battery-powered applications that require FPGA functionality.

  7. Q: Does the LCMXO3L-6900C-6BG256C support communication protocols like SPI and I2C? A: Yes, the LCMXO3L-6900C-6BG256C supports various communication protocols, including SPI, I2C, UART, and GPIO, allowing easy integration with other devices.

  8. Q: Can I use the LCMXO3L-6900C-6BG256C for real-time signal processing? A: Yes, the LCMXO3L-6900C-6BG256C's high-speed performance and flexible I/O capabilities make it suitable for real-time signal processing applications.

  9. Q: Are there any development boards available for the LCMXO3L-6900C-6BG256C? A: Yes, Lattice Semiconductor provides development boards like the LCMXO3L-EVN, which allow users to prototype and test their designs using the LCMXO3L-6900C-6BG256C.

  10. Q: Where can I find technical documentation and support for the LCMXO3L-6900C-6BG256C? A: You can find technical documentation, datasheets, application notes, and support resources on the official website of Lattice Semiconductor or by contacting their customer support team.

Please note that the answers provided here are general and may vary depending on specific requirements and use cases.